Выбрать VPSДата-ЦентрыСообщество
Поддержка
Войти
RUS
₽RUB
8 (800) 775 97 42
Бесплатно, круглосуточно
 
Мои серверы
Домены
Баланс:
Заказать
Настройки
Партнеру
 
Личный кабинет
  • ВЫБРАТЬ VPS
  • ДАТА-ЦЕНТРЫ
  • СПРАВОЧНИК
  • ПОДДЕРЖКА
  • ВОЙТИ
RuVDS/Справочник/Настройка VPS Сервера/Как настроить Nginx на Ubuntu 20.04

Как настроить Nginx на Ubuntu 20.04

67 просмотров 0 2021-01-20 2021-01-22

Nginx является одним из самых распространённых инструментов создания веб-серверов, который в настоящее время активно используется для работы многими сайтами. Ниже, о том, как настроить Nginx на сервере Ubuntu 20.04.

Установка Nginx

Прежде чем настроить Nginx, его надо установить. Установку проще всего производить из репозиториев Ubuntu, а значит, для исталляции необходимо войти в систему учётной записью, имеющей привилегию на запуск команды sudo и последовательно выполнить следующие команды:

$ sudo apt update
$ sudo apt install nginx

Первая инструкция выполняет обновление базы данных доступных для установки пакетов. Вторая выполняет установку элементов веб-сервера Nginx.

На этом всё, что касается установки Nginx. Переходим к его настройке.

Настройка веб-сервера Nginx

При настройке веб-сервера Nginx, первым делом следует уделить внимание брандмауэру, используемому операционной системой вашего сервера. Для защиты подключений к вашей системе, с точки зрения простоты использования и надёжности, наиболее оптимально подойдёт такой инструмент как Uncomplicated Firewall (UFW). Чтобы увидеть профили приложений, о которых знает UFW, используйте инструкцию:

$ sudo ufw app list

Список этих приложений выглядит так:

sudo ufw app list при настройке Nginx на Ubuntu 20.04

Чтобы подключаться к Nginx используя HTTP, введите команду:

$ sudo ufw allow 'Nginx HTTP'

и проверьте статус UFW:

$ sudo ufw status

Должно быть примерно так:

sudo ufw status при настройке Nginx на Ubuntu 20.04

Поскольку веб-сервер устанавливается как служба, проверить статус Nginx можно командой:

$ systemctl status nginx
systemctl status nginx при настройке Nginx на Ubuntu 20.04

Теперь, когда вы убедились в том, что веб-сервер Nginx запущен, можно попробовать подключиться к нему через браузер набрав в нем IP-адрес вашего VPS. Если настройки выполнены корректно, браузер должен вывести такое сообщение:

Начальная страница Nginx

Важные директории и файлы настроек Nginx

В заключении будет нелишним перечислить наиболее важные в части настройки и проведения анализа работы файлы и папки для настроенного веб-сервера Nginx.

  • /var/www/html – директория, где распологается начальная страница Nginx (см. выше).
  • /etc/nginx – директория, в которой находятся основные файлы настроек Nginx.
  • /etc/nginx/nginx.conf – файл, содержащий главные настройки конфигурации Nginx.
  • /etc/nginx/sites-enabled – в данной папке находятся активные виртуальные блоки веб-сервера Nginx.
  • /etc/nginx/sites-available – директория, в которой находятся файлы виртуальных блоков для каждого из сайтов, ссылка на них должна быть в каталоге /etc/nginx/sites-enabled.
  • /etc/nginx/snippets – каталог, содержащий так называемые сниппеты, которые можно при необходимости подключать к основной конфигурации сервера Nginx.
  • /var/log/nginx – директория, которая содержит журналы событий работы Nginx.

Статья полезна?

Да  Нет
Похожие статьи
  • Как отключить конфигурацию усиленной безопасности и настроить Internet Explorer в Windows Server
  • Как изменить или добавить язык в Windows Server
  • Как обновить CentOS 8 до CentOS Stream
  • Как настроить Nginx в качестве веб-сервера и обратного прокси-сервера для Apache на одном сервере Ubuntu 20.04
  • Как централизовать логи с помощью Journald в Ubuntu 20.04
  • Первоначальная настройка VPS сервера с Ubuntu 20.04
Оставить комментарий Отменить ответ

Популярные статьи
  • RDP: Как подключиться к виртуальному серверу Windows?
  • Как настроить звук на сервере при RDP-подключении: для Mac и Windows
  • Как настроить VPN, используя OpenVPN и Streisand
  • Настройка локальной сети через ZeroTier
  • Как получить и скопировать список установленных пакетов на Ubuntu / Debian Linux сервере
Разделы Справочника
  • Настройка VPS Сервера
  • Начало работы
  • Особенности виртуального сервера
  • Партнерам
  • Развертывание ПО на VPS сервере
  • Сетевые настройки сервера
GAME OVERNIGHT
CLOUDRUSSIA
STRATONET
VPS/VDS серверы:
Тестовый период
Дешевый VPS
VPS Старт
VPS Турбо
VPS с 1C
Форекс VPS
Игровые серверы
VPS на Украине
Пинг до дата-центров
Услуги:
Антивирусная защита
Аренда лицензий
Страхование
Облачное хранилище
Страхование для юридических лиц
VPS серверы с Plesk Obsidian
Клиентам:
О компании
Дата-Центры
Новости
Публичная Оферта
Политика обработки персональных данных
Сувениры от RuVDS
Партнерам:
Партнерская программа
API
Помощь:
Справочник
FAQ
Созданных
серверов
231504
Huawey
Supermicro
Cisco
Intel
Microsoft
ISP
Kaspersky
RuVDS
support@RUVDS.com
8 (800) 775-97-42
+7 (495) 135-10-99
МЫ В СОЦИАЛЬНЫХ СЕТЯХ
Copyright © 2021 RuVDS. Все права защищены.